The station is equipped with essential amenities, ensuring a smooth travel experience. Although there isn't a ticket office, travelers can easily purchase and collect pre-bought tickets from the available ticket machines, which are designed to accommodate all users, including those with accessibility needs. Smartcard users will find validators on site; however, issuing of new smartcards is not available here.
For passengers needing assistance, the station is ready to address inquiries via a help point. While staff assistance isn't directly available, a robust lost property service ensures misplaced items are duly handled. Security is a priority with CCTV coverage providing an additional layer of comfort.
Travelers should note that Kirkby-in-Ashfield station categorizes as a Category C station, meaning it does not offer step-free access to platforms, unlike neighboring stations like Mansfield. Yet, tactile paving at the platform edges provides vital cues for those with visual impairments. It's crucial for those requiring specific access needs to plan their journey accordingly, potentially utilizing other stations with better facilities if necessary.
Given the limited parking and absence of bicycle storage, it's encouraging that alternate transportation methods are within reach. The station has a dedicated bus service, allowing travelers to seamlessly continue their journey. Rail replacement services are perfectly positioned to ensure minimum disruption during train outages. Hatch End might be a small station, but it is equipped with key facilities that cater to the needs of its travelers. There’s a ticket office open from Monday to Friday, between 07:30 to 10:10, and ticket machines for easy purchases at any time. If you’ve booked your tickets online, you're in luck, as you can collect them conveniently at these machines as well. Access for those requiring special assistance is reasonably catered for, with step-free access available on the northbound platform and staff ready to lend a helping hand via help points. However, do note there are no accessible toilets or baby changing facilities available on-site. While refreshments and shopping options are not available, there are multiple seating areas, offering a comfortable waiting spot before your train departs.
Seamless transport connections are crucial, and Hatch End provides several options. For those affected by rail work or disruptions, the rail replacement services ensure you can continue your journey with ease. Buses from bus stop 'X' on Uxbridge Road will take you to either Watford Junction northbound or Harrow & Wealdstone southbound. For taxi services, although there isn’t a dedicated rank, a taxi office is conveniently located right outside the station entrance. Additionally, the closest Underground connection is the Harrow & Wealdstone station, just a short 6-minute train journey away.
